I Killed My Husband (Completed Main Story) - Chapter 5
“Oh, sorry, sorry…”
“Shh. Just a moment.”
“Your Majesty, this, this…”
“Move too hastily, and you might fall again—calm down for now.”
It wasn’t wrong. Her flowing gown had tangled around her feet. Carlos held Mercedes close, saying nothing.
In that brief instant, her expression was invisible.
Mercedes felt as if she might go mad with anxiety. To be held like this… This might truly be catastrophic.
“Your Majesty, I am calm now. Please let me go.”
“…Very well.”
Carlos replied in a low voice, slowly releasing her.
“Y-Your Majesty…”
She knelt on one knee, then untangled the gown wrapped around her leg.
The heat of Carlos’s body brushed against Mercedes’s cold skin. She felt a strange shiver and tried to step back.
But Carlos held her ankle tightly, refusing to let go.
“I can manage, Your Majesty! I apologize—please, rise at once—”
Mercedes pleaded with him, her voice trembling. But Carlos spoke calmly, continuing.
“Is this your taste? The gown is beautiful, but utterly impractical.”
Carlos murmured as he smoothed the gown, then rose again. Standing face to face, he was truly tall—his frame seemed twice her size.
Overwhelming. Yet, strangely, not threatening.
“Thank you. But for Your Majesty to kneel for someone like me—”
“Prudence is admirable. But your prudence seems to have a reason. Isn’t that so?”
A sudden, piercing question. Mercedes widened her eyes, then turned her head away.
“…I wish to return. Please grant me leave.”
She wanted to escape this unease now.
“I already granted it. Go whenever you wish.”
“Thank you. I hope you have a restful night.”
Mercedes bowed swiftly, turned, and fled from the courtyard.
Afterward, she ran—clutching the hem of her gown in her hands, bare legs exposed.
She ran, and ran again.
Fearing someone might have seen.
And because the shiver that had risen when his hand touched her had not yet faded.
[This is the timeline separator]Carlos Rivera.
The Emperor of the Room Empire was rumored to be traveling among minor neighboring states, and it was said he would stay only one night in Shaym.
Yet something strange occurred.
The next day, the Emperor did not depart.
As a result, the palace servants of Shaym, who had been exhausted from preparing for the Emperor’s arrival, had no time to rest and continued bustling through the palace halls, looking as if they might collapse at any moment.
They said the Emperor had requested to remain longer, praising Shaym’s beauty to the King.
Upon hearing this news, Mercedes refused to leave her chambers—afraid of encountering the Emperor.
Her reclusive habits were routine, so no one paid her any attention. One day, what did it matter?
And that night,
Richard summoned her.
[This is the timeline separator]Recently, Richard had mentioned consummation. And now he summoned her at night.
For these two reasons alone, the maids dressed her elaborately. “Who knows,” they said, “if you’re not beautiful, we’ll be scolded.”
Dressed and adorned, Mercedes’s eyes were lifeless, yet her entire appearance was radiant, exquisite, and strangely captivating.
‘It couldn’t be consummation.’
Hadn’t the very idea of consummation been introduced to humiliate her?
Even if he didn’t consummate, it would be a miracle if he didn’t hurl a wine bottle at her.
‘At least the Baron’s violence ended after our marriage…’

Now she might return to such a life. Her stomach churned; a headache surged.
And as expected, the moment she entered the chamber, Mercedes realized consummation was out of the question.
Richard sat in the dim room, lit by a single candle, drinking strong liquor. The smoke from his cigarette was so potent she immediately began coughing.
“You summoned me, c-cough, cough… Your Majesty?”
Still, she offered her greeting with as upright a posture as she could manage. But she was certain today would be unlike any other.
Richard’s gaze, fixed on her as he drank, burned with an intensity unlike any she’d ever seen.
Like a man driven mad with rage.
“Mercedes. Mercedes. My wife.”
“…Yes, Your Majesty.”
“Come closer.”
“Yes.”
Mercedes forced down her fear and stepped forward, standing before him.
“Mercedes. Though your rumors are quiet now… they will intensify again once the Emperor departs. Do you understand?”
“…Yes.”
The continent’s victor had not yet left. Though attention was drawn to him, everyone remained silent—fearing that if the Crown Princess’s scandal resurfaced, Shaym’s dignity would suffer.
The Emperor had said he might linger capriciously, but once he departed, the rumors would inevitably rise again, pressing upon Mercedes.
All pressure against her came from Richard. If he refused to relent, the noose would tighten until it choked her.
“I think… the Emperor is staying because of you. Suddenly deciding to remain, isn’t he? Hah… Have my suspicions been wrong, Wife?”
Richard clenched his teeth. A grinding sound echoed.
“…What do you mean?”
Startled by the unexpected question, Mercedes lowered her eyes, feigning calm.
“I mean exactly what I said. The Emperor cannot be unaware of your rumors. He has countless capable informants.”
“Your Majesty… are you suggesting the Emperor of Room is staying in Shaym longer merely to suppress my rumors?”
“Indeed, my wife. You understand so quickly. Hmm? Such a sharp mind. You’ve always been clever.”
Richard swayed, clearly drunk on the potent liquor.
“That cannot be. The Emperor would never concern himself so deeply—”
“Mercedes.”
Richard gave a bitter smile.
“Do you think I don’t know?”
“…Yes?”
“My filthy wife, who lost her purity to another man. What absurdity is this? Isn’t it?”
“What do you mean…?”
She had never spent her wedding night with Richard.
Now, suddenly, purity?
“Last night, at dawn. You think I didn’t see? You and the Emperor, meeting secretly in the courtyard.”
At Richard’s words, Mercedes’s heart plummeted. Her entire body froze.
Richard had seen her—and the Emperor—last night.
“No wonder the Emperor interferes so excessively in other people’s marriages… How long have you been clinging to him? How long has he been here, hmm?”
“No, Your Majesty. I could never—”
“You shut yourself in your chambers. How could I know? You never come to seek your husband… Well, the maids say you never leave your room.”
Richard lifted the wine bottle and drank straight from it.
“Dawn is another time, isn’t it? You looked so close together in the courtyard. Have you met the Emperor alone before?”
“No, no! That morning, we met by chance. The Emperor helped me when I was about to fall. Your Majesty, you misunderstand—”
“You always insist your words are right. Mine are wrong. I’ve tolerated your disregard for your husband—yes, for the future ruler of this kingdom—but even my patience has limits. Do you understand?”
Richard’s voice rose.
Mercedes had no idea where to begin unraveling this misunderstanding, how to escape it.
But there was no misunderstanding. In truth, Richard knew her innocence.
Richard had always stationed watchers to monitor Mercedes. She was his possession.
The night before, he had rolled in drunken revelry with courtesans until he grew bored. Then his watcher reported that Mercedes had left her chambers. So he moved.
Guided, he arrived at the courtyard.

In that moment of surprise, he witnessed the two of them.
Yes. Mercedes had truly met the Emperor by chance that morning—and the Emperor had simply caught her as she stumbled.
Mercedes had pushed him away, insisting she must go. The Emperor had told her to do as she wished.
It was a trivial matter.
Yet he could not suppress his fury.
From Mercedes’s trembling voice, to the vivid image of the two standing side by side as if made for each other—it all flashed before his eyes.
The Emperor even seemed to suit Mercedes better than his own brother.
And that night, the Emperor had unmistakably stolen Mercedes’s gaze.
From that dawn until now, Richard had not slept a single moment. He drank, thought, and thought again. And meanwhile, the Emperor refused to leave the kingdom.
“Please, truly, misunderstand me no more. I have not left my chamber since the welcome banquet—”
“You’ve clung to another man. Mercedes. Should I forgive you?”
“Your Majesty! It is truly a misunderstanding!”
“Enough, Mercedes. I’ve made up my mind.”
“Your Majesty… please, just hear me once.”
“Now you look a little more human.”
Richard smirked.
“Yes. I’ve found one way to resolve all this.”
He threw something onto the table between them. A metallic clang echoed.
“It seems you simply need to disappear. Why don’t you take care of it yourself?”
The object thrown was a dagger.
Mercedes stared blankly at the dagger.
“This dagger… what does it mean…?”
“Has your mind broken too?”
Richard looked at Mercedes, bewildered by her failure to comprehend, with a look of disdain.
“What need would you have to use the dagger yourself? Do you think I would order you to kill someone? What could you possibly do with arms as thin as twigs?”
“…Ah.”
Slowly, understanding dawned. Mercedes’s vacant eyes flickered. Simultaneously, her clasped hands tightened, her nails digging into her skin.
“Are you… commanding me to take my own life, now?”
Mercedes asked, struggling to remain composed.
But her voice trembled uncontrollably.
Richard smiled as he watched her. With unmistakable delight.
